Job Description

Job Responsibilities:

  • Assists Training & Education Supervisor in confirming conference, seminar and webinar speakers.
  • Schedules and attends session planning calls with event speakers.
  • Collects presentations, bios and photos from speakers for use in webinars, marketing materials and on-site collateral; maintains speaker database.
  • Acts as project manager for conference mobile app; ensures all information is timely and accurate; liaises with marketing and meeting planning to coordinate promotion efforts and encourage attendee usage.
  • Acts as project manager for webinars; oversees webinar event setup; ensures attendee communications templates are accurate for each event; coordinates logistics among speakers, internal staff and platform vendor; monitors live broadcasts to answer audience questions and ensure the event runs smoothly.
  • Travels to events as needed to help manage speakers and logistics.
  • Manages attendee evaluation process for assigned events.
  • Oversees materials shipments from office to live events.
  • Serves a liaison between Customer Service and Accounting departments to process speaker registrations and travel expense reimbursements while maintaining speaker expense budget.
  • Tracks event logistics expenses.
  • Performs other general administrative duties as assigned.

 Job Requirements: 

  •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Communications, Hotel Management or related field.
  • 3+ years of relevant work experience.
  • Ability to demonstrate solid project management, organizational and written/oral communication skills.
  • Thorough and detail-oriented with the ability to work efficiently in a fast-paced environment and adhere to deadlines.
  • Advanced computer skills in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Outlook.
  • Ability and willingness to travel domestically and internationally on behalf of the company (10-20% travel).
  • Copywriting, editing and/or proofreading experience is a plus. 
  • Fluent English is a must (spoken and written), with an additional Asian language (e.g. Chinese, Japanese, Indonesian) is a plus.
  • A “whatever it takes to get things done” and team-oriented attitude and approach
